Real Madrid arrives in the Liga Endesa ACB to meet Morabanc Andorra after a turbulent EuroLeague week. The team suffered a road loss at Buesa Arena and now faces questions over personnel choices.

EuroLeague aftermath and Baskonia defeat

The club lost to Baskonia in Vitoria. The result renewed worries about the team’s form away from the Movistar Arena.

Foul trouble limited the frontcourt. Mamadi Diakité shone for Baskonia. Real Madrid’s bigs struggled to contain him.

Interior absences and on-court issues

Several interior players missed minutes in that game. Alex Len was sidelined with injury concerns.

Trey Lyles traveled despite an ankle sprain but did not play. Coach Sergio Scariolo also left Izan Almansa out of the rotation.

Selection debate and Izan Almansa

The omission of Izan Almansa sparked debate online. Many fans questioned Scariolo’s rotation choices after the defeat.

Almansa is usually relied upon in ACB matches. He has shown defensive promise and steady performances when used.

Up next: Morabanc Andorra

Morabanc Andorra sit low in the ACB standings. That status suggests this match could be a clear chance for adjustments.
